Screw jacks are used for a wide variety of purposes in industry and often form an integral part of a processing line. Commonly used in the steel industry, paper manufacturing, mineral mining and coal mining, as well as textile, rubber and plastics manufacturing.
Replacement Screw Jacks
Experience shows that where a screw jack needs to be replaced in an existing line, it is often better to replace with an exact equivalent, as the casing size and holes for location will be in the correct position.

SE Series worm gear screw jacks
The loads covered by the SE Series of Worm Gear Screw Jacks range from 2,000kg (2 tons) to 50,000kg (50 tons) but jacks outside this range can be supplied.
The jacks are designed to give linear movement for either light or heavy duty applications: for lifting, lowering, pulling or pushing to the full rated jack capacity. These versatile units can be used singly, in series or in multiple jacking arrangements. They can be operated by hand, or by electric, air or hydraulic motor. A further advantage is that two or more Jacks can be operated in unison. This is achieved by using mitre gearboxes and inter-connected shafts and couplings, to produce a completely synchronised movement and therefore an even lift.
All jacks are self-locking and will not creep under load. A full range of models is available including upright, inverted or rotating screw types with Top Plate, Threaded or Clevis End or any other special end to suit your requirements. Keyed models are also available where the design is such that the lifting-screw end is not secured to the load.
